Output 058c23dbb23f7af020c6cf57cfa414c2a4d51d7b5c40e86262f254f7a7745aa3:18

value
680672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a9da89df6bc94fe6bb9523cc19b0849c9e25a1c OP_EQUALVERIFY OP_CHECKSIG
address
16Lw4SdeBLag4ReyHnqCk4oNMyKfs1vDmd
transaction
058c23dbb23f7af020c6cf57cfa414c2a4d51d7b5c40e86262f254f7a7745aa3
spent
true